How Does a Grind By Weight Espresso Grinder Improve Dosing Accuracy?
A grind by weight espresso grinder improves dosing accuracy by measuring the coffee grounds in real-time during the grinding process. This method ensures that the amount of coffee used for each brew is consistent and precise.
Step 1: Measurement System – Grind by weight grinders use a scale to continuously measure the coffee grounds as they are being ground. This system allows for immediate feedback on the amount being processed.
Step 2: Target Weight Input – Users can set a specific target weight for the desired coffee dose. The grinder automatically stops grinding once it reaches this predetermined weight.
Step 3: Reduction of Variability – Traditional grinders often rely on time-based dosing, which can lead to variability due to fluctuations in grind size or coffee density. Grind by weight eliminates this variability by focusing on the actual amount of grounds produced.
Step 4: Consistency Across Shots – By achieving consistent dosing, these grinders ensure that each espresso shot maintains the same flavor profile and strength. This leads to better overall brew quality.
Step 5: Waste Reduction – Accurate dosing minimizes coffee waste. Users avoid over or under dosing, which can negatively impact the taste of the coffee.
Each of these steps emphasizes the importance of precision in espresso brewing. The combination of real-time measurement, target input, and consistency contributes to improved dosing accuracy with grind by weight espresso grinders.
How Does Grind Consistency Influence Overall Coffee Quality?
Grind consistency significantly influences overall coffee quality. Uniform particle size helps achieve even extraction of flavors. When coffee grounds are of varying sizes, smaller particles can over-extract while larger ones may under-extract. This leads to an imbalanced taste profile.
First, consider the brewing method. Different methods, like espresso or French press, require specific grind sizes. For instance, espresso needs a fine grind for quick extraction. A consistent grind ensures each particle extracts flavor similarly, enhancing the overall taste.
Next, look at brewing time and temperature. Consistency affects how long water interacts with coffee. If the grind is uneven, some grounds will release flavors too quickly while others won’t release enough. This inconsistency negatively impacts the final brew.
Lastly, examine the coffee’s aroma and body. A consistent grind allows for full flavor release, producing a richer aroma and balanced body. In summary, grind consistency directly impacts extraction uniformity, brewing method suitability, and flavor profile, leading to an overall improved coffee experience.

How Should You Care for Your Grind By Weight Espresso Grinder?
To care for your Grind By Weight Espresso Grinder, follow essential maintenance practices to ensure optimal performance and longevity. Regular cleaning is critical. Aim to clean the grinder after every use. Use a soft brush to remove coffee grounds from the burrs. Deep cleaning should occur every few weeks, or more often based on usage.
First, disassemble the grinder according to the manufacturer’s instructions. This process may include removing the hopper and burrs. Clean these parts separately. Immerse removable parts in warm water, but avoid submerging the motor unit. Use a damp cloth to wipe down the exterior.
Second, monitor the grind settings. Adjust the grind size based on the brewing method. Finer grinds are typically suitable for espresso, while coarser settings are better for French press. Consistent settings maintain flavor integrity.
Third, store your grinder in a dry place away from humidity and extreme temperatures. Excess moisture can lead to mold growth, while extreme heat can damage the electronics.
Additionally, consider the type of coffee beans used. Oils from oily beans can clog the burrs more quickly. Opt for fresh, medium-roasted beans to minimize buildup.
Factors such as frequency of use and environment can influence maintenance needs. A busy café may require daily cleaning and adjustments, while home use might only necessitate weekly checks.
Careful attention to these aspects ensures your Grind By Weight Espresso Grinder operates effectively, delivering consistent coffee quality over time.
